Complete Tax Breakdown

Detailed line-by-line tax calculation for a Fine Artists, Including Painters, Sculptors, and Illustrators earning $31,780 in Ohio (single filer, standard deduction).

Tax Component Annual Amount Effective Rate
Gross Salary (Median) $31,780
Federal Income Tax -$1,829 5.8%
Ohio State Income Tax -$157 0.5%
Social Security (OASDI) -$1,970 6.2%
Medicare -$460 1.5%
Total Taxes -$4,418 13.9%
Take-Home Pay $27,361 86.1%

After-Tax Pay by Experience Level

Take-home pay varies significantly across experience levels. Here is the after-tax breakdown for each salary percentile of Fine Artists, Including Painters, Sculptors, and Illustrators in Ohio.

Percentile Gross Salary Total Taxes Take-Home Pay Tax Rate
10th Percentile (P10) $22,860 -$2,574 $20,285 11.3%
25th Percentile (P25) $24,190 -$2,809 $21,380 11.6%
Median (P50) $31,780 -$4,418 $27,361 13.9%
75th Percentile (P75) $43,750 -$7,099 $36,650 16.2%
90th Percentile (P90) $63,750 -$11,779 $51,970 18.5%

How is Fine Artists, Including Painters, Sculptors, and Illustrators take-home pay in Ohio calculated?

We start with the 2025 BLS median salary of $31,780 for Fine Artists, Including Painters, Sculptors, and Illustrators in Ohio, then subtract: federal income tax using 2024 IRS brackets ($14,600 standard deduction), Ohio state income tax (progressive (up to 3.5%)), Social Security (6.2% up to $168,600), and Medicare (1.45%). The result — $27,361/yr — does not include local taxes, pre-tax deductions (401k, HSA), or tax credits.

Tax Calculation Assumptions

This estimate assumes a single filer using the 2024 standard deduction ($14,600), with W-2 employment income only. It does not account for: itemized deductions, tax credits (e.g. earned income credit, child tax credit), local/city taxes, pre-tax contributions (401k, HSA, FSA), self-employment tax, or additional income sources. Actual take-home pay may differ. Consult a tax professional for personalized advice.
